Alliance for Animals
The Alliance for Animals is a 501(c)(3)
non-profit organization devoted to educating the public and public officials
on animal abuse and how to make positive and meaningful changes. We have
been in Madison for over 19 years and have helped implement changes both in
Wisconsin and nationwide. We concentrate heavily on direct advocacy, humane
education and outreach, and legislation.
Our meetings are held the second Monday of
every month at 7 pm in the fourth floor conference room at: 122 State Street
in Madison. Our meetings are open to the public. Membership to the Alliance
is $25/year for general and $15/year for students. Membership includes our
quarterly newsletter, animal news and all action alerts sent via mail.

Campus Vegetarian
Society CVS
provides resources for anyone
interested in a plant-based diet, raise awareness of vegetarianism and
veganism, promote motivations for a vegetarian lifestyle: religion, ethics,
environment, health.
Some of our events include:
potluck dinners,
speakers, cooking workshops, cooking competitions, food giveaways, working
with University Housing to provide healthy plant-based options, and working
with area restaurants.

Madison Coalition
for Animal Rights MCAR strives to
peacefully advocate for non-human animals through outreach, education, and
active animal rights campaigning. We believe that all animals have inherent
dignity and deserve respect. They are not made for human consumption, use,
entertainment, or abuse. MCAR exists to promote compassionate lifestyle
choices to students and to improve the lives of non-human and human animals
at the University of Wisconsin.
Meetings are every Monday at 7pm in the
Humanities Building on the UW Campus. Check
TITU for the room
number.
